Overview

Essen Health Care is the largest privately held, multispecialty medical group in New York, providing high-quality, compassionate care to some of the state’s most vulnerable and underserved residents.


Founded in 1999, we’ve grown from a single primary care office into a network of 50+ locations offering urgent care, primary care and specialty services, from women’s health to endocrinology and psychiatry. We also provide nursing home support, care management, and in-home care through our Essen House Calls program. Guided by a Population Health model, our team of 500+ providers deliver care in-person, at home, or via telehealth, ensuring patients get the support they need when and where they need it.

Job Summary

Title: Assistant VP, Marketing - Essen Health Care | Location: Bronx, NY | Reports to: VP of Marketing 

Role Overview: Essen Health Care is seeking a strategic, data-driven AVP of Marketing to serve as the Vice President’s strategic partner and operational leader of the marketing function. In this high impact role, you will be responsible for architecting and executing comprehensive Go-To-Market (GTM) strategies that address the full marketing funnel; from building brand awareness and strengthening consideration to converting communities into lifelong patients. The AVP will translate enterprise growth objectives into measurable marketing strategies, oversee performance media and analytics, guide A/B testing and optimization frameworks, and ensure campaigns are aligned with business unit revenue goals. This leader must combine strategic thinking with hands-on fluency across Google Ads, Meta Ads, LinkedIn Ads, CRM tools, and digital attribution models. 

Responsibilities

Key Responsibilities: Go-To-Market Strategy & Full-Funnel Leadership 

  • Develop and execute integrated GTM strategies across Intention Healthcare, Nursing Home, Care Management and new service expansions. 
  • Design full-funnel frameworks spanning: Awareness (CTV, Linear, Paid SM) Consideration (SEM, Retargeting, Email), Conversion (High-intent SEM, Landing Page CRO) 
  • Partner with Operations to align marketing strategy with office site-level growth targets. 
  • Develop dashboards and reporting cadences that translate performance metrics into executive insights. 
  • Continuously optimize CPLs, appointment conversion rates, CPAs, and ROAS. 
  • Establish and manage structured A/B testing framework across: Creative, Audiences, and CRO pages 
  • Partner with analytics to refine attribution modeling and enhance reporting accuracy. 
  • Drive data-informed decision-making across the marketing department. 
  • Collaborate with Creative Teams and media partners to ensure performance alignment. 
  • Ensure bilingual and culturally relevant messaging across campaigns. 
  • Build scalable marketing workflows and processes. 
  • Monitor competitive landscape and healthcare marketing trends.
